At 11:55 PM -0400 4/18/99, Bruce R. Nevins wrote:
>I would like to have htdig follow those links as well as the standard
>ones. Is there a way to do this, even if I have to include special
>tags in comments to force it to follow. I would like to avoid having
>to create a list of URLs that would have to be added to the
>configuration file.
I'm afraid not. The fact is, there are just *way* too many ways people try
to have "links" on pages. I don't know of any spider that follows what
you've mentioned.
Your choices are to either compile a list of links as Torsten suggested, or
to have text links on the page. Remember that the config file can include
other files, e.g.:
start_url: `${common_dir}/my.urls`
